Navigating Licensed German Online Casino Regulations
In Germany, the landscape of online gambling is strictly governed by the State Treaty on Prizing and Gambling (GlüStV 2021). This legislation mandates that all online casino, poker, and sports betting operators must obtain a specific license. This regulatory framework is designed to ensure fair play, player protection, and responsible gambling practices across the country. Without a valid license issued by the Joint Gambling Authority of the Länder (GGL), operating such services within Germany is illegal. Player Protection and Responsible Gaming Initiatives
A significant focus of the German online gambling regulations is the protection of players. Licensed operators are required to implement robust responsible gaming measures. This includes providing access to self-exclusion tools, setting deposit and session limits, and offering information and links to counseling services for those who may be experiencing gambling-related harm. The goal is to foster a culture where gambling is enjoyed responsibly and safely.
